The Bible is replete with powerful narratives, and among the most compelling are the stories of its women. "Women of the Bible" brings to the forefront the lives, struggles, and triumphs of these extraordinary figures, offering a rich tapestry of faith, courage, and resilience.
From the Old Testament to the New Testament, women play pivotal roles in shaping the spiritual and cultural landscape of biblical times. Their stories are diverse, reflecting a range of experiences and challenges that resonate deeply with readers even today.
Consider the story of Eve, the first woman, whose life marked the beginning of human existence and the complexity of human choice. Her narrative explores themes of temptation, fallibility, and redemption. Sarah, the matriarch of the Hebrew people, exemplifies patience and faith as she awaits the fulfillment of God's promise in her old age.
Ruth, a Moabite widow, demonstrates loyalty and devotion, embodying the power of love and commitment. Her journey from loss to redemption highlights the importance of steadfastness and the transformative power of faith. Esther, a queen who risked her life to save her people, represents courage and strategic wisdom. Her story is a testament to the impact one individual can have in the face of adversity.
The New Testament introduces us to Mary, the mother of Jesus, whose humility and obedience play a critical role in the Christian narrative. Her life is a profound example of faith and maternal love. Mary Magdalene, often misunderstood, emerges as a devoted follower of Jesus, her life a testament to redemption and unwavering faith.
Martha and Mary of Bethany offer contrasting but equally important perspectives on service and devotion. Martha's practical service and Mary's contemplative listening to Jesus provide a balanced view of spiritual life and discipleship.
Each of these women, along with many others, offers invaluable lessons. They navigated a world often hostile to their autonomy and worth, yet their stories are preserved in sacred scripture as enduring testimonies of their strength and significance. Their lives underscore the universal themes of love, sacrifice, faith, and perseverance.
"Women of the Bible" serves as a powerful reminder of the indomitable spirit of these biblical women. Their stories not only enhance our understanding of the Bible but also inspire us to confront our own challenges with grace and strength. As we delve into their narratives, we find that their journeys are not so different from our own, and their faith continues to light our path.
